Title: Usability Analyst
Description: The Thomas Industrial Network, www.thomasnet.com, is the largest division of a leading b-to-b information publisher (please visit us at www.thomaspublishing.com). We deliver detailed sourcing information to the industrial buyer and we offer a wide range of online catalog and e-commerce solutions to industrial sellers. Our Audience Development Team is currently seeking a Usability Analyst to analyze Thomasnet.com web user behavior via a Web Metrics application.
Specific Responsibilities include:
- Manage the process of researching and analyzing audience user behavior
- Work closely with our developers to create more robust and actionable reporting deliverables for Senior Management
- Work with management to outline analytic strategies
· Create analytics plan; set benchmarks, goals, and data-driven responses
· Maintain appropriate documentation utilizing a propriety software program
Required Experience: Qualified candidates must have at least 1-2 years experience analyzing Web Metrics (preferably webtrends) along with analyzing data and compiling analytic reports. College degree required (BA/BS), preferably in Computer Science, MIS, or related field.
Detailed knowledge of statistics and SPSS and working knowledge of database and web architecture. Experience in A/B webtesting and/or multivariate testing and database marketing are a plus. Any web and/or SQL programming also a plus.
